As nouns, unresponsiveness is a hypernym of frigidness; that is, unresponsiveness is a word with a broader meaning than frigidness:
  • frigidness: sexual unresponsiveness (especially of women) and inability to achieve orgasm during intercourse
  • unresponsiveness: the quality of being unresponsive; not reacting; as a quality of people, it is marked by a failure to respond quickly or with emotion to people or events
Other hypernyms of frigidness include deadness.
